Renowned clergyman and founder of Christ Embassy, Pastor Chris Oyakhilome, has issued a stern warning to Nigerians against criticizing pastors and other ministers of God.
Speaking during a recent sermon to his congregation, Pastor Chris cautioned that anyone who speaks against God’s anointed servants risks bringing curses upon themselves.
In his words:
“Don’t criticise God’s people, especially the ministers of God. I say leave them alone. For the Bible says whatever they do, they do unto the Lord. Don’t join anybody to criticise other ministers, because there are curses against those who do.”
The pastor’s statement has sparked widespread debate online, with mixed reactions from social media users.
